  1. Microsound is a genre of electronic music that focuses on the manipulation of very small sound fragments, often at the level of individual samples or even individual waveforms. Artists in this genre use granular synthesis, time-stretching, and other techniques to create intricate and detailed compositions that explore the subtle nuances of sound.

  2. A cousin to the glitch genre, microsound explores the lower and higher frequencies of the sound spectrum through digital and analog signal processing, granular synthesis, and micromontage. It focuses largely on the arrangement of sound particles within a composition.

  5. Arrangement of microsounds on an incredibly small time scale. Read more Micromontage is the arrangement of sounds (known as microsounds) on an incredibly small time scale. These sounds usually last from 10 milliseconds to less than a tenth of a second.
